> > Well, Warp and Mu records, both better get themselves
> > sorted out soon, as Ant Zen are quickly replacing them
> > at the cutting edge of electronica/IDM...and it isn't
> > even due to the artists on the labels...its the image
> > too...
> >
> > I went to the two recent V. Snares gigs in London (2
> > nights in a row, helps to compare, lots) - the first
> > night, was a Warp night, with Mike Paradinas and a
> > bunch of other Warp folk about...the second night was
> > an Ant Zen night, with Stephan (head Ant himself)
> > DJing and some other acts...
> >
> > First night was dull...lots of pretencious folk, in
> > lo-fi dress (well arranged clothing, in a shabby
> > style) - general vibe, was of a private view at a
> > really head-up-your-own-arse art show...V. Snares got
> > little reaction out of the crowd...drug of choice for
> > the evening, by most folk, was charlie...of course...
> >
> > Second night was great...good support before V.
> > Snares, apart from the DJ just before, who is the
> > resident @ the Slimelight (the name of the night, they
> > were playing at) ...he played the usual cyber-goth
> > rubbish, with the odd bit of Converter/Hypnoskull type
> > stuff thrown in, to keep the crowd from falling
> > asleep...but the crowd were generally up for it...and
> > the dancefloor was full of maniacs jumping around, and
> > enjoying themselves, not standing at the side,
> > scratching their chins (with the appropriate hairs
> > attached in the Frank Zappa style that suits)...V.
> > snares was wicked...took the last trancey style track
> > that was being played, screwed it about, and just
> > messed with the crowd until they stopped dancing, then
> > did his thing...
> >
> > As for an acid revival...what about Ceephax Acid Crew
> > (Squarepusher's brother, I believe) - he's doing a
> > fine job there...
